The industry of online poker is growing day by day. There are thousands of online poker sites and a lot of players are looking for the best rooms available in the market. Playing online poker is quite profitable if you have minimal skills. And if you are a beginner, one of the best things about playing online poker are poker bonuses.
Poker Bonuses are incentive referral codes that allow you to get an extra percentage of money in your bankroll when signing up in a new poker room. Take into account that most of these poker bonuses are active when playing an specific amount of hands. Poker bonuses are the best way to increase your deposit. For instance, a room may offer a poker player who deposits $100 a bonus of 100% up to $1000 once he plays X raked hands.

The bonuses we've mentioned before are normally offered to new players. The player deposits and gets a percentage (usually between 10% and 150% in most cases). First deposit bonuses have limits as low as $10 and maximun of $500 and don't forget there are requirements to cash out. You need a minumun amount to risk / bet! That's why it's important to read the rules and terms and conditions.

Features of a Good Online Poker Guide
- The number of people making the transition from the traditional poker to online poker has been on the rise, in recent days. By traditional poker, we mean that which was played around tables with physically tangible cards, whereas by online poker, we mean that which is played over the Internet using 'virtual cards' by people who can be, and often are, miles apart.
- Now most of the people making this transition will usually express an interest in gaining insight into the workings of online poker. So will the numerous other people whose first encounter with poker is over the Internet (and there are many such people, especially youngsters, who are encountering many things online before they have had the opportunity to experience them in the 'offline world'). For all these people, the solution that is usually given as a way through which they can get to learn the workings of internet poker is by getting a good online poker guide.
- There are many such online poker guides. And as with most things in life, the makers of each will make claims that theirs is the very best. The intended user of the poker guide, on the other hand, will be keen on getting that which can be termed as the very best online poker guide, so as to make their learning of the workings of online poker fast and effective. This is what leads them to a situation where they express an interest in knowing what goes into the making of a good internet poker guide - so that they can use that criterion in making a selection out of the numerous available resources developed and meant to guide poker players, as they get started on the game online.
- Few people will argue with the assertion that a good online poker guide would be one that is written by credible authorities. A poker guide written by people who have actually been successfully involved in the game (over the Internet) would be better than one written by people whose understanding of poker is purely academic. It is very hard, actually impossible, to properly teach people that which you do not actually know at a personal level. A good way to check out the credibility of the authors of the various resources that are meant to guide poker players as they get started on the game online would be by conducting (internet) searches using their names, to see whether they have successful poker playing histories. At the very least, you should look at the credentials they present on the said poker guides, to see whether those make them authorities in the area.
- A good online poker guide is that which is comprehensive in its coverage (rather than one that is skimpy in its coverage) of issues to do with Internet-based poker. In this regard, a good guide would be one that answers most questions that a novice would be likely to have regarding online poker. And this is important because we have seen resources meant to guide poker players who are making their first steps in the game online - but which far from answering the questions such novices to online poker are likely to have, ended up leaving them with even more questions! Comprehensiveness therefore becomes a very important factor here.
- A good poker guide is one that is readable. This entails a number of things. Ideally, it should be presented in a reader-friendly format, which at the most basic level, would include careful choice of things such as fonts styles, font sizes graphic design and so on. At a more fundamental level, it would be the sort of a guide that moves the reader from 'the known into the unknown' - using things that the reader is obviously likely to conversant with as the foundations on which to build new knowledge. It should be a guide that takes into consideration the readers' likely ignorance of matters to do with online poker without insulting their intelligence. It should be a guide that is clear from ambiguities. The makers of an online poker guide (as indeed the makers of any other type of guide) are supposed to know that the main reason people make reference to such guides is in an effort to clear ambiguities. It therefore does not make sense to present them with even more ambiguities, right in the guides they refer to in a bid to get clarification.

The Real Poker Crack to Winning Online Poker

You have probably heard players complain that pokerstars is rigged or you may have seen someone chatting about the full tilt rigged debate online; however is there a way around cracking poker to avoid the rigged sites and the bad beats? There is a real poker crack to winning if you follow a well laid out plan to win.
- In order to win at poker, you must first lay out a plan that will give you a chance to win. One of the most effective poker strategies to build your bankroll, is to play a sit n go poker tournament. The best of these are the double or nothing sit n go's where you are playing against 9 other players and 5 of those players will get paid double their buy in.
- One of the major reasons many people will claim pokerstars or full tilt is rigged, is because of the bad beats they get when playing. Top pair will get rivered by two pair and a straight will lose to a flush more times than it is seemingly possible. However, you can avoid a lot of the suck outs in poker online by following the same pattern and strategy each time you play.
- One of the best ways to do this is to get a poker guide or book and follow the advice exactly in the book. Although you may have already played hundreds of poker hands in no limit Texas holdem, if you formulate a specific plan and style of play, this will give you an edge against some of the less experienced players in the field.
- Once you have found a poker book that you are comfortable with, adapt that style to your play and follow the advice as closely as possible in each scenario. The real way to crack poker is to have a plan, stick to that plan and do not allow your emotions to overcome your good common sense in the game.
- Face it, you are not going to get dealt pocket aces every hand, and you are rarely going to make the top nuts on the flop, so you need as much information to develop your winning style as possible. In other words, should you bluff at a pot when everyone checks or should you try and trap your opponents when you have a made poker hand?
- Answering these questions is all a part of developing your style and sticking with your plan to win. Take the time to learn many different poker strategies to advance your knowledge and help you succeed in winning. After all, if the only strategy you ever use is bluffing or aggression, your opponents will quickly adapt and recognize your style of play and soon you will find yourself another victim of a bad beat!
